Real Estate Jobs Basics
Learn about real estate jobs so you can make an informed career choiceBy Angela Roe, Freelance Writer With real estate jobs ranging from real estate brokers to office support, there is likely a career in real estate that is sure to fit your personality and your professional goals. Office support staff manage the phones, make appointments and keep the real estate agents and brokers on schedule. Open house hosts oversee new development open houses during off peak hours, typically during the week. These positions require people skills and basic computer skills, while real estate agents and brokers must meet educational requirements in order to become licensed to do business.
To learn more about real estate employment, talk to various real estate organizations and request job shadowing options so you can educate yourself on all real estate job opportunities. By job shadowing each career option, you get a more in-depth view of what that profession entails. To learn more about real estate jobs basics:

Use professional affiliations to learn about real estate positions
Make networking a priority. Join professional organizations that require ethical standards for members and offer benefits such as networking opportunities, meetings, webinars and support for its members. Use these organizations as a way to gather information on different types of real estate careers to help you narrow your choices.

Educate yourself for real estate positions you desire
Evaluate the real estate career you want to build, and focus on the courses and training you need to receive in order to be successfully qualified for that position. From basic computer skills to ongoing coaching, choose the education that teaches you to be the professional you want to be.
